Some examples of word usage: exocrine gland
1. The pancreas is an example of an exocrine gland that produces digestive enzymes.
2. The sweat glands are exocrine glands that help regulate body temperature.
3. The salivary glands are exocrine glands that produce saliva to aid in digestion.
4. The sebaceous glands are exocrine glands that produce oil to lubricate the skin and hair.
5. The mammary glands are exocrine glands that produce milk for breastfeeding.
6. The lacrimal glands are exocrine glands that produce tears to keep the eyes moist.
7. The liver contains exocrine glands that produce bile to aid in digestion.
8. The prostate gland is an exocrine gland that produces fluid to nourish and protect sperm.
9. The exocrine glands in the stomach produce gastric juices to help break down food.
10. Disorders of the exocrine glands can lead to issues such as dry skin, poor digestion, and decreased milk production.
